Researcher profile

Luigi Brugnano

Luigi Brugnano cont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 21 - EmergingVerification L1Unclaimed author
19works
0followers
4top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

19 published item(s)

preprint2022arXiv

(Spectral) Chebyshev collocation methods for solving differential equations

Recently, the efficient numerical solution of Hamiltonian problems has been tackled by defining the class of energy-conserving Runge-Kutta methods named Hamiltonian Boundary Value Methods (HBVMs). Their derivation relies on the expansion of the vector field along the Legendre orthonormal basis. Interestingly, this approach can be extended to cope with other orthonormal bases and, in particular, we here consider the case of the Chebyshev polynomial basis. The corresponding Runge-Kutta methods were previously obtained by Costabile and Napoli [33]. In this paper, the use of a different framework allows us to carry out a novel analysis of the methods also when they are used as spectral formulae in time, along with some generalizations of the methods.

preprint2022arXiv

Arbitrarily high-order energy-conserving methods for Poisson problems

In this paper we are concerned with energy-conserving methods for Poisson problems, which are effectively solved by defining a suitable generalization of HBVMs, a class of energy-conserving methods for Hamiltonian problems. The actual implementation of the methods is fully discussed, with a particular emphasis on the conservation of Casimirs. Some numerical tests are reported, in order to assess the theoretical findings.

preprint2022arXiv

Arbitrary high-order methods for one-sided direct event location in discontinuous differential problems with nonlinear event function

In this paper we are concerned with numerical methods for the one-sided event location in discontinuous differential problems, whose event function is nonlinear (in particular, of polynomial type). The original problem is transformed into an equivalent Poisson problem, which is effectively solved by suitably adapting a recently devised class of energy-conserving methods for Poisson systems. The actual implementation of the methods is fully discussed, with a particular emphasis to the problem at hand. Some numerical tests are reported, to assess the theoretical findings.

preprint2022arXiv

Continuous-Stage Runge-Kutta approximation to Differential Problems

In recent years, the efficient numerical solution of Hamiltonian problems has led to the definition of a class of energy-conserving Runge-Kutta methods named Hamiltonian Boundary Value Methods (HBVMs). Such methods admit an interesting interpretation in terms of continuous-stage Runge-Kutta methods, which is here recalled and revisited for general differential problems.

preprint2020arXiv

Arbitrarily high-order energy-preserving methods for simulating the gyrocenter dynamics of charged particles

Gyrocenter dynamics of charged particles plays a fundamental role in plasma physics. In particular, accuracy and conservation of energy are important features for correctly performing long-time simulations. For this purpose, we here propose arbitrarily high-order energy conserving methods for its simulation. The analysis and the efficient implementation of the methods are fully described, and some numerical tests are reported.

preprint2020arXiv

On the use of the Infinity Computer architecture to set up a dynamic precision floating-point arithmetic

We devise a variable precision floating-point arithmetic by exploiting the framework provided by the Infinity Computer. This is a computational platform implementing the Infinity Arithmetic system, a positional numeral system which can handle both infinite and infinitesimal quantities symbolized by the positive and negative finite powers of the radix grossone. The computational features offered by the Infinity Computer allows us to dynamically change the accuracy of representation and floating-point operations during the flow of a computation. When suitably implemented, this possibility turns out to be particularly advantageous when solving ill-conditioned problems. In fact, compared with a standard multi-precision arithmetic, here the accuracy is improved only when needed, thus not affecting that much the overall computational effort. An illustrative example about the solution of a nonlinear equation is also presented.

preprint2010arXiv

Blended General Linear Methods based on Boundary Value Methods in the GBDF family

Among the methods for solving ODE-IVPs, the class of General Linear Methods (GLMs) is able to encompass most of them, ranging from Linear Multistep Formulae (LMF) to RK formulae. Moreover, it is possible to obtain methods able to overcome typical drawbacks of the previous classes of methods. For example, order barriers for stable LMF and the problem of order reduction for RK methods. Nevertheless, these goals are usually achieved at the price of a higher computational cost. Consequently, many efforts have been made in order to derive GLMs with particular features, to be exploited for their efficient implementation. In recent years, the derivation of GLMs from particular Boundary Value Methods (BVMs), namely the family of Generalized BDF (GBDF), has been proposed for the numerical solution of stiff ODE-IVPs. In particular, this approach has been recently developed, resulting in a new family of L-stable GLMs of arbitrarily high order, whose theory is here completed and fully worked-out. Moreover, for each one of such methods, it is possible to define a corresponding Blended GLM which is equivalent to it from the point of view of the stability and order properties. These blended methods, in turn, allow the definition of efficient nonlinear splittings for solving the generated discrete problems. A few numerical tests, confirming the excellent potential of such blended methods, are also reported.

preprint2010arXiv

Energy and quadratic invariants preserving integrators of Gaussian type

Recently, a whole class of evergy-preserving integrators has been derived for the numerical solution of Hamiltonian problems. In the mainstream of this research, we have defined a new family of symplectic integrators depending on a real parameter. When it is zero, the corresponding method in the family becomes the classical Gauss collocation formula of order 2s, where s denotes the number of the internal stages. For any given non-null value of the parameter, the corresponding method remains symplectic and has order 2s-2: hence it may be interpreted as a symplectic perturbation of the Gauss method. Under suitable assumptions, it can be shown that the parameter a may be properly tuned, at each step of the integration procedure, so as to guarantee energy conservation in the numerical solution. The resulting method shares the same order 2s as the generating Gauss formula, and is able to preserve both energy and quadratic invariants.

preprint2010arXiv

Hamiltonian Boundary Value Methods (Energy Conserving Discrete Line Integral Methods)

Recently, a new family of integrators (Hamiltonian Boundary ValueMethods) has been introduced, which is able to precisely conserve the energy function of polynomial Hamiltonian systems and to provide a practical conservation of the energy in the non-polynomial case. We settle the definition and the theory of such methods in a more general framework. Our aim is on the one hand to give account of their good behavior when applied to general Hamiltonian systems and, on the other hand, to find out what are the optimal formulae, in relation to the choice of the polynomial basis and of the distribution of the nodes. Such analysis is based upon the notion of extended collocation conditions and the definition of discrete line integral, and is carried out by looking at the limit of such family of methods as the number of the so called silent stages tends to infinity.

preprint2010arXiv

Isospectral Property of Hamiltonian Boundary Value Methods (HBVMs) and their blended implementation

One main issue, when numerically integrating autonomous Hamiltonian systems, is the long-term conservation of some of its invariants, among which the Hamiltonian function itself. Recently, a new class of methods, named "Hamiltonian Boundary Value Methods (HBVMs)" has been introduced and analysed, which are able to exactly preserve polynomial Hamiltonians of arbitrarily high degree. We here study a further property of such methods, namely that of having, when cast as Runge-Kutta methods, a matrix of the Butcher tableau with the same spectrum (apart the zero eigenvalues) as that of the corresponding Gauss-Legendre method, independently of the considered abscissae. Consequently, HBVMs are always perfectly A-stable methods. Moreover, this allows their efficient "blended" implementation, for solving the generated discrete problems.

preprint2010arXiv

Isospectral Property of Hamiltonian Boundary Value Methods (HBVMs) and their connections with Runge-Kutta collocation methods

One main issue, when numerically integrating autonomous Hamiltonian systems, is the long-term conservation of some of its invariants, among which the Hamiltonian function itself. Recently, a new class of methods, named Hamiltonian Boundary Value Methods (HBVMs) has been introduced and analysed, which are able to exactly preserve polynomial Hamiltonians of arbitrarily high degree. We here study a further property of such methods, namely that of having, when cast as a Runge-Kutta method, a matrix of the Butcher tableau with the same spectrum (apart from the zero eigenvalues) as that of the corresponding Gauss-Legendre method, independently of the considered abscissae. Consequently, HBVMs are always perfectly A-stable methods. This, in turn, allows to elucidate the existing connections with classical Runge-Kutta collocation methods.

preprint2010arXiv

Numerical comparisons between Gauss-Legendre methods and Hamiltonian BVMs defined over Gauss points

Hamiltonian Boundary Value Methods are a new class of energy preserving one step methods for the solution of polynomial Hamiltonian dynamical systems. They can be thought of as a generalization of collocation methods in that they may be defined by imposing a suitable set of extended collocation conditions. In particular, in the way they are described in this note, they are related to Gauss collocation methods with the difference that they are able to precisely conserve the Hamiltonian function in the case where this is a polynomial of any high degree in the momenta and in the generalized coordinates. A description of these new formulas is followed by a few test problems showing how, in many relevant situations, the precise conservation of the Hamiltonian is crucial to simulate on a computer the correct behavior of the theoretical solutions.

preprint2010arXiv

Numerical Solution of ODEs and the Columbus' Egg: Three Simple Ideas for Three Difficult Problems

On computers, discrete problems are solved instead of continuous ones. One must be sure that the solutions of the former problems, obtained in real time (i.e., when the stepsize h is not infinitesimal) are good approximations of the solutions of the latter ones. However, since the discrete world is much richer than the continuous one (the latter being a limit case of the former), the classical definitions and techniques, devised to analyze the behaviors of continuous problems, are often insufficient to handle the discrete case, and new specific tools are needed. Often, the insistence in following a path already traced in the continuous setting, has caused waste of time and efforts, whereas new specific tools have solved the problems both more easily and elegantly. In this paper we survey three of the main difficulties encountered in the numerical solutions of ODEs, along with the novel solutions proposed.

preprint2010arXiv

The Hamiltonian BVMs (HBVMs) Homepage

Hamiltonian Boundary Value Methods (in short, HBVMs) is a new class of numerical methods for the efficient numerical solution of canonical Hamiltonian systems. In particular, their main feature is that of exactly preserving, for the numerical solution, the value of the Hamiltonian function, when the latter is a polynomial of arbitrarily high degree. Clearly, this fact implies a practical conservation of any analytical Hamiltonian function. In this notes, we collect the introductory material on HBVMs contained in the HBVMs Homepage, available at http://web.math.unifi.it/users/brugnano/HBVM/index.html

preprint2009arXiv

Fifty Years of Stiffness

The notion of stiffness, which originated in several applications of a different nature, has dominated the activities related to the numerical treatment of differential problems for the last fifty years. Contrary to what usually happens in Mathematics, its definition has been, for a long time, not formally precise (actually, there are too many of them). Again, the needs of applications, especially those arising in the construction of robust and general purpose codes, require nowadays a formally precise definition. In this paper, we review the evolution of such a notion and we also provide a precise definition which encompasses all the previous ones.

preprint2009arXiv

Parallel Factorizations in Numerical Analysis

In this paper we review the parallel solution of sparse linear systems, usually deriving by the discretization of ODE-IVPs or ODE-BVPs. The approach is based on the concept of parallel factorization of a (block) tridiagonal matrix. This allows to obtain efficient parallel extensions of many known matrix factorizations, and to derive, as a by-product, a unifying approach to the parallel solution of ODEs.